Understanding Metal Fabrication: The Foundation of Modern Manufacturing

Metal fabrication is a collective term for processes that transform raw metal sheets, plates, bars, and other forms into usable components and structures. It involves a series of precise operations including cutting, welding, forming, machining, and finishing—each essential in ensuring the final product meets stringent quality standards.

Whether it’s creating a custom aerospace component or manufacturing durable construction beams, metal fabricators wield a combination of advanced technology and seasoned craftsmanship. Their expertise extends across diverse metals, including steel, aluminum, brass, copper, and specialty alloys, allowing them to tailor solutions for various industrial applications.

The Evolution and Significance of Metal Fabricators in Industry

Over the decades, metal fabricators have evolved from traditional artisans to highly automated and technologically advanced entities. The integration of Computer Numerical Control (CNC) machinery, laser cutting, robotic welding, and 3D modeling has revolutionized production capabilities, enabling higher precision and faster turnaround times.

This evolution not only enhances efficiency but also widens the scope for innovation—permitting the creation of intricate parts and complex assemblies with unmatched accuracy. In industries such as aerospace, automotive, medical devices, and architectural design, high-quality metal fabrication is crucial for safety, durability, and performance.

The Critical Role of Lathe Parts Suppliers in Metal Fabrication

Among the myriad tools and components that power modern manufacturing, lathe parts stand out as a cornerstone of precision machining. Lathe parts suppliers provide the essential components—such as spindles, chucks, tool holders, gears, and lead screws—that ensure lathes operate with exceptional accuracy and reliability.

Integrating Innovation in Metal Fabrication Processes

To stay ahead in today’s competitive landscape, metal fabricators must continually incorporate innovations. These include:

  • Automation and Robotics: Streamlining repetitive tasks like welding and assembly for consistency and speed.
  • Advanced Material Technologies: Utilizing composite materials and alloys for lightweight yet strong components.
  • Digital Twins and Simulation: Employing 3D modeling to forecast manufacturing outcomes and troubleshoot issues before production begins.
  • Sustainable Manufacturing: Reducing waste and energy consumption through smarter processes and eco-friendly materials.

Choosing the Right Lathe Parts Supplier: Key Considerations

Selecting an ideal lathe parts supplier involves evaluating several critical factors:

  1. Product Quality: Verify material certifications and testing results.
  2. Reputation and Experience: Prefer suppliers with proven track records and industry recognition.
  3. Customization Capabilities: Ensure they can produce bespoke components if needed.
  4. Cost and Lead Time: Balance competitive pricing with reliable delivery schedules.
  5. Technical Support: Access to expert advice and after-sales service for troubleshooting and upgrades.
